We are currently seeking a Junior Communication Engineer (EIT). The Junior Communications Engineer will support the planning, design, coordination, and implementation of communications and low-voltage systems for large-scale infrastructure and transportation projects. The ideal candidate has hands-on experience with fire alarm systems, network systems, and low-voltage communications, and is comfortable working in a multidisciplinary construction and engineering environment.
This role will collaborate closely with design teams, construction managers, contractors, and public agency stakeholders to ensure systems are compliant, constructible, and successfully delivered.
Responsibilities
- Design, review, and coordinate fire alarm systems in accordance with applicable codes, standards, and authority having jurisdiction (AHJ) requirements
- Develop and review communications and low-voltage system designs, including structured cabling, fiber optics, CCTV, access control, PA/VMS, and network infrastructure
- Support infrastructure and transportation projects such as transit facilities, tunnels, stations, roadways, bridges, and related facilities
- Review contractor submittals, shop drawings, RFIs, and technical proposals
- Provide construction-phase support including site inspections, testing and commissioning support, and system acceptance
- Coordinate system interfaces with IT, electrical, and other building systems
- Ensure compliance with project specifications, industry standards, and safety requirements
- Participate in meetings with clients, agencies, designers, and contractors
- Assist with cost estimates, schedules, and risk assessments related to communications systems
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Communications Engineering, or a related field (or equivalent experience)
- 2+**** years of experience in communications or low-voltage systems within construction, engineering, or infrastructure projects
- Engineer in Training (EIT) certification required
- Working knowledge of relevant codes and standards (e.g., NFPA, NEC, local AHJ requirements)
- Experience supporting construction management or design-build projects
- Strong technical writing and communication skills
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ience on transportation or infrastructure projects (transit, rail, roadway, aviation, or utilities)
- Professional Engineer (PE) license preferred
- NICET certification (Fire Alarm or related disciplines)
- Familiarity with public agency projects and compliance requirements
- Experience with system integration and testing/commissioning processes
